Level 33, Wollongong's second-largest landholder, has revealed its ambitious plans for future development, positioning itself as a key player in the city's transformation. The company, which owns significant parcels of land across the region, aims to focus on a mix of residential and commercial projects that will reshape the urban landscape.
Strategic Vision for Growth
In a recent announcement, Level 33 outlined a strategic vision that prioritizes sustainable growth and community integration. The company plans to develop high-density residential towers, mixed-use precincts, and commercial spaces that cater to the evolving needs of Wollongong's population. These projects are expected to create thousands of jobs and boost the local economy.
Residential Developments
The residential component of Level 33's plan includes the construction of modern apartment complexes designed to accommodate the city's growing workforce. These developments will feature green spaces, energy-efficient designs, and amenities that promote a high quality of life. The company emphasized its commitment to affordable housing, with a portion of units allocated for key workers and first-home buyers.
Commercial and Retail Spaces
Level 33 also intends to revitalize the city's commercial core by building new office towers and retail hubs. These spaces will attract businesses from various sectors, including technology, finance, and professional services. The company is collaborating with local authorities to ensure that the developments align with Wollongong's long-term urban plan.
Community and Environmental Impact
Recognizing the importance of community feedback, Level 33 has engaged in extensive consultations with residents and stakeholders. The company has pledged to incorporate public input into its designs, particularly regarding traffic management, public transport access, and green infrastructure. Environmental sustainability is a key focus, with all projects targeting carbon neutrality and water conservation.
Timeline and Next Steps
Level 33 expects to submit development applications for the first phase of projects within the next six months. Construction could begin as early as 2025, with completion scheduled for 2028. The company has assured that it will work closely with the local council to ensure a smooth approval process.
